Australia Market Report of September 17: Losses Smaller Than Expected SEP 17, 2008 14:00 - Article Views: 5,969 The share market dropped almost 2% yesterday after Wall Street dropped 4% to its lowest close since the September 2001 terrorist attacks. A late rally among major banks and gains in resources stocks kept the local damage from the fall out from the Lehman Brothers collapse to a minimum. The losses were not as bad as expected but the combined losses of the past two days were significant. |
